96SEO 2025-09-01 18:21 1
MySQL是世界上最流行的开源关系数据库管理系统之一,广泛应用于各种规模的应用程序。只是即使在Debian系统上,MySQL也可能遇到故障。所以呢,了解如何高效排查MySQL故障对于系统管理员来说至关重要。

MySQL网络连接故障可能是由于多种原因引起的,如配置错误、网络问题、权限问题等。
确认/etc/mysql/或/etc/mysql/中的配置正确, 如bind-address数据目录路径等。
确保MySQL服务监听的端口未被其他应用程序占用,并检查网络连接是否正常。
使用以下命令检查MySQL服务状态:
sudo systemctl status mysql
若未运行,尝试启动:sudo systemctl start mysql。
检查系统资源是否充足,以排除资源不足导致的故障。
MySQL主从复制故障可能是由于同步延迟、数据不一致、网络问题等原因引起的。
检查主从服务器的错误日志,以获取故障信息。
使用以下命令检查同步延迟:
SHOW SLAVE STATUS;
比较主从服务器上的数据,确保数据一致性。
检查主从服务器之间的网络连接是否正常。
MySQL权限问题可能导致用户无法连接到数据库。
使用以下命令检查用户权限:
GRANT ALL PRIVILEGES ON . TO 'myuser'@'%' IDENTIFIED BY 'mypassword' WITH GRANT OPTION;
确保MySQL数据目录权限正确:
sudo chown -R mysql:mysql /var/lib/mysql
sudo chmod -R 750 /var/lib/mysql
通过以上步骤,您可以有效地排查和解决Debian系统上的MySQL故障。在遇到问题时请按照本文提供的步骤进行排查和解决。
Demand feedback